nan- все статьи тега


Питон панды - построение многомерной сводной таблицы, чтобы отобразить количество Нанс и non-Нанс

У меня есть набор данных, основанный на различных метеостанциях для нескольких переменных (температура, давление и т. д.), stationID | Time | Temperature | Pressure |... ----------+------+-------------+----------+ 123 | 1 | 30 | 1010.5 | 123 | 2 | 31 | 1009.0 | 202 | 1 | 24 | NaN | 202 | 2 | 24.3 | NaN | 202 | 3 | NaN | 1000.3 | ... И я хотел бы создать сводную таблицу, которая показывал ...

В программировании на языке Си будет ли вычисление медленнее, если любая переменная в выражении является nan

Это совершенно гипотетический вопрос. В приведенном ниже коде я выполняю вычисление, которое имеет одну переменную, z, в качестве значения, присвоенного "nan". Основной расчет будет медленнее по сравнению с нормальным значением z (например, z = 1.0) float z = 0.0/0.0; // that means z is "nan" float p = 50.0, q = 100.0, r = 150.0; // main calculation Type 1 float c = ((x*100)+(y*100))/(x*100)+(y*100)+152*(p+q/r)+z; Вот пример, чтобы показать основной расчет с нормальным значением z float z ...

Заполнение NaN в фрейме данных на основе значений столбца

У меня есть данные, которые напоминают следующий упрощенный пример: Col1 Col2 Col3 a A 10.1 b A NaN d B NaN e B 12.3 f B NaN g C 14.1 h C NaN i C NaN ...на многие тысячи рядов. Мне нужно заполнить LNA, основываясь на значении в Col2, используя что-то аналогичное методу ffill. Результат, который я ищу, таков: Col1 Col2 Col3 a A 10.1 b A 10.1 d B ...

Интерполировать значения NaN в массиве numpy

Есть ли быстрый способ заменить все значения NaN в массиве numpy (скажем) линейно интерполированными значениями? Например, [1 1 1 nan nan 2 2 nan 0] Будет преобразовано в [1 1 1 1.3 1.6 2 2 1 0] ...

Как вы проверяете, что число NaN в JavaScript?

Я только пробовал это в консоли JavaScript Firefox, но ни один из следующих операторов не возвращает true: parseFloat('geoff') == NaN; parseFloat('geoff') == Number.NaN; ...

Проверка, является ли двойной (или плавающий) NaN в C++

есть ли функция isnan ()? PS.: Я в MinGW (если это имеет значение). я решил это с помощью isnan () from <math.h>, который не существует в <cmath>, который находился #includeing сначала. ...

Как проверить, является ли какое-либо значение NaN в кадре данных Pandas

в Python Pandas, каков наилучший способ проверить, имеет ли фрейм данных одно (или несколько) значений NaN? Я знаю о функции pd.isnan, но это возвращает фрейм данных булевых значений для каждого элемента. Этот пост прямо здесь не совсем отвечает на мой вопрос. ...

В чем разница между (НАН!= НАН) и (НАН!= = НАН)?

прежде всего я хочу отметить, что я знаю, как isNaN() и Number.isNaN() работа. Я читаю Определенное Руководство Дэвид Фланаган и он дает пример того, как проверить, если значение NaN: x !== x в результате true, если и только если x и NaN. но теперь у меня есть вопрос: почему он использует строгое сравнение? Потому что кажется, что x != x ведет себя точно так же. Безопасно ли использовать оба версии, или мне не хватает некоторых значений в JavaScript, которые будут возвращать true на x != ...

Быстрая проверка для NaN в NumPy

Я ищу самый быстрый способ проверить наличие NaN (np.nan) в массиве NumPy X. np.isnan(X) не может быть и речи, так как он строит логический массив shape X.shape, который потенциально гигантские. пробовал np.nan in X, но это, кажется, не работает, потому что np.nan != np.nan. Есть ли быстрый и эффективный для памяти способ сделать это вообще? (для тех кто спросит "как гигантский": я не могу сказать. Это проверка ввода кода библиотеки.) ...

Присваивая переменной значение NaN в Python и NumPy без

большинство языков имеют константу NaN, которую можно использовать для присвоения переменной значения NaN. Может ли python сделать это без использования numpy? ...

В чем разница между quiet NaN и signaling NaN?

Я читал о плавающей точке, и я понимаю, что NaN может быть результатом операций. но я не могу понять, что именно это за понятия. В чем разница? какой из них может быть создан во время программирования на C++? Как программист, могу ли я написать программу, вызывающую sNaN? ...